[0001] The utility model relates to the technical field of file arrangement equipment, specifically is intelligent file arrangement platform. BACKGROUND

[0002] The intelligent file arrangement platform is an innovative product integrating modern technology and file management requirements, which not only considers the efficiency of file arrangement, but also pays attention to the protection of files and the health of staff. Dust lung disease, occupational poisoning and occupational dermatosis are common among staff in archives and libraries. This is because the air circulation is not smooth during the storage of files, the long-term storage of files and books is easy to accumulate dust, paper aging and ink evaporation, which causes the surface of files to accumulate dust with bacteria, various molds and harmful pathogenic substances. When the staff arranges files, the skin is easy to contact and inhale the dust, thereby causing occupational diseases. At the same time, the accumulation of dust also affects the long-term preservation of files, so we need to propose the intelligent file arrangement platform. SUMMARY

[0003] The utility model aims at providing intelligent file arrangement platform, aims at solving the problem that when the staff arranges files, the skin is easy to contact and inhale the dust, thereby causing occupational diseases. At the same time, the accumulation of dust also affects the long-term preservation of files.

DETAILED DESCRIPTION

[0020] The technical solutions in the embodiments of the utility model will be clearly and completely described below with reference to the drawings in the embodiments of the utility model. Obviously, the described embodiments are only part of the embodiments of the utility model, rather than all the embodiments. Based on the embodiments in the utility model, all other embodiments obtained by those skilled in the art without creative labor fall within the scope of protection of the utility model.

[0021] Please refer to Figures 1-4 The utility model provides a technical scheme:

[0022] The intelligent file arrangement table comprises an operation table 1, two groups of stand cabinets 2 are fixedly installed at the bottom of the operation table 1, a negative pressure air suction port 3 is formed in the top of the operation table 1, the negative pressure air suction port 3 is communicated with the inside of the stand cabinet 2, an ultraviolet lamp 4 is arranged on the inner wall of the stand cabinet 2, the stand cabinet 2 is arranged below the ultraviolet lamp 4 and is provided with an adsorption assembly 5 for collecting the pollutants mixed in the file, a fan 6 is fixedly installed at the inner bottom of the stand cabinet 2, a cover plate 7 is fixedly connected to the side wall of the stand cabinet 2 through a plurality of groups of fixed screws, a through slot 8 is formed in the side wall of the cover plate 7, and a dust screen 9 is fixedly embedded in the inside of the through slot 8. The utility model adopts the integrated design of file arrangement and disinfection, simplifies the file arrangement operation process, saves space and time cost, can effectively remove formaldehyde, TVOC, benzene and other complex gaseous pollutants, the PM2.5 primary purification rate is as high as 99%, the management table has very obvious effect on removing paper scraps, dust and smoke, and adopts the air purification mode of negative pressure dust collection, so that the phenomenon that pollutants are inhaled into the nose of the staff during the arrangement operation is avoided.

[0023] The adsorption assembly 5 comprises two groups of mounting plates 501, high-efficiency filter screen plates 502 and activated carbon filter elements 503, the two groups of mounting plates 501 are fixedly installed on the inner walls of the two sides of the stand cabinet 2 respectively, the high-efficiency filter screen plates 502 are arranged on the opposite sides of the two groups of mounting plates 501, and the top of the activated carbon filter element 503 is fixedly connected with the bottom of the high-efficiency filter screen plate 502.

[0024] It should be noted that the high-efficiency filter screen plate 502 can efficiently remove dust particles in the air, effectively purifying the environment during the arrangement process. During the arrangement process of the archives, due to the frequent turning and moving of the archives, a large amount of dust and dust particles are easily generated. These dust particles not only cause potential damage to the archives, but also may cause harm to the respiratory system of the workers. The high-efficiency filter screen plate 502 can capture extremely small dust particles, keep the arrangement environment clean, and thus protect the archives and the health of the workers;

[0025] Secondly, the activated carbon filter element 503 can remove harmful and toxic gases such as formaldehyde and benzene series in the air. These harmful gases often come from the archives materials themselves or the surrounding environment. Long-term exposure to such an environment will harm the health of workers. The activated carbon filter element 503 has strong adsorption capacity and can effectively remove these harmful gases in the air to create a safe and healthy archive arrangement environment.

[0026] The opposite side walls of the two groups of mounting plates 501 are respectively provided with a plurality of insertion grooves 10 matched with the high-efficiency filter screen plate 502. The two sides of the high-efficiency filter screen plate 502 are respectively inserted into the two groups of insertion grooves 10. By using the mounting plate 501 and the insertion groove 10 in cooperation, the high-efficiency filter screen plate 502 and the activated carbon filter element 503 can be conveniently disassembled and assembled.

[0027] The bottom of the operation table 1 is symmetrically fixed with two groups of sliding rails 11. The opposite sides of the two groups of sliding rails 11 are slidably connected with a collection box 12. The collection box 12 serves as a storage space and can store various archive arrangement tools, accessories or small devices. This not only reduces the clutter on the workbench and makes the overall environment more tidy, but also facilitates workers to quickly find the required items, thereby improving work efficiency.

[0028] The top of the operation table 1 is provided with a recess 13. The inside of the recess 13 is fixedly installed with a touch screen 14. The intelligent archive arrangement table further comprises a temperature and humidity sensor (not shown in the figure). The temperature and humidity in the storage working environment can be monitored, recorded and displayed on the screen in real time. For example, the values of PM2.5 and TVOC are displayed on the intelligent screen. The intelligent screen is easy to understand.

[0029] A plurality of threaded blind holes 15 are formed in the side wall of the vertical cabinet 2. A plurality of threaded through holes 16 matched with the threaded blind holes 15 are formed in the side wall of the cover plate 7. One end of a plurality of fixing screws is respectively threaded into the inside of the threaded blind holes 15 through the plurality of threaded through holes 16.

[0030] The top of the fan 6 is an air inlet, the side of the fan 6 is an air outlet, and the air outlet is communicated with the outside through a through groove 8; by starting the fan 6, a negative pressure can be generated at the negative pressure air suction port 3, and paper scraps, dust and smoke above the operation table 1 can be adsorbed and then enter the inside of the cabinet 2;

[0031] The ultraviolet lamp 4 comprises a mounting shell 401 fixedly installed on the inner wall of the cabinet 2, the mounting shell 401 is provided in a back type, and lamp tubes 402 are installed on four inner walls of the mounting shell 401 respectively; the sterilization efficiency of the archives can reach 99% by adopting the nano light hydrogen sterilization technology, and the use requirement of the archives disinfection of the archives bureau is met.

[0032] The utility model adopts F6 medium effect filter + nanometer light hydrogen ion + TIO2 nanometer catalytic net + composite gas high -efficient filter, effectively purifies indoor microorganism, particulate pollutant and gaseous pollutant, solves the purification treatment of various harmful gas and pollutant of archives in the arrangement on one hand, on the other hand, because it adopts five -level air filtration purification design, 99% removes dust, microorganism in air, PM2.5 primary purification efficiency can reach 99% above, also effectively avoids the damage to health of the archives arrangement personnel in the work.
